Course programme

DESCRIPTION
Anyone wishing to automate common worksheet operations, convert worksheets into forms and understand Excel VBA code.

PREREQUISITES
Must be confident or at least have had sufficient exposure to the concepts covered in Levels 1-3.


Revision of Level 3

Creating Add-Ins (mini Excel applications)
  • What? Why?
  • The Add-ins dialog box
  • Adding descriptive information
  • Creating
  • Opening
  • Distributing
  • Modifying

Manipulating Windows Explorer
  • Creating, Deleting, Renaming folders
  • Copying / Moving / Renaming files
  • Getting a list of all files in a folder

Absorbing lists of data to be use elsewhere
  • Arrays

    • Declaring and using redim
    • Multidimensional arrays
    • Dynamic Arrays
    • Using an Array

  • ADO Recordsets

    • Creating
    • Filtering
    • Sorting
    • Adding new records to
    • Counting records
    • Pasting into a sheet
Intro to Integrating with other Office Applications
  • Setting References
  • Starting another application
  • Activating the application
  • Outlook
    • Sending an email through Outlook
    • Sending separate emails per region

  • Word

    • Creating a memo with a chart

  • Access

    • Attaching to a database and appending the spreadsheet data
